available<\/h2>\n\n\n\n<p>Once the Ubuntu terminal is open, you can check individual tools with simple version commands.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Check Python<\/h3>\n\n\n\n<p>Enter:<\/p>\n\n\n\n<p><code>python3 --version<\/code><\/p>\n\n\n\n<p>If Python 3 is available, the terminal will return its installed version.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Check the C compiler<\/h3>\n\n\n\n<p>Enter:<\/p>\n\n\n\n<p><code>gcc --version<\/code><\/p>\n\n\n\n<p>When GCC is installed, Ubuntu will display the compiler version.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Check the C++ compiler<\/h3>\n\n\n\n<p>Enter:<\/p>\n\n\n\n<p><code>g++ --version<\/code><\/p>\n\n\n\n<p>This command checks for the GNU C++ compiler.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Check Go<\/h3>\n\n\n\n<p>Enter:<\/p>\n\n\n\n<p><code>go version<\/code><\/p>\n\n\n\n<p>If Go is available, its installed version will appear.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Check Rust<\/h3>\n\n\n\n<p>Enter:<\/p>\n\n\n\n<p><code>rustc --version<\/code><\/p>\n\n\n\n<p>Similarly, this command tells you whether the Rust compiler is available.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Check Ruby<\/h3>\n\n\n\n<p>Enter:<\/p>\n\n\n\n<p><code>ruby --version<\/code><\/p>\n\n\n\n<p>If Ruby is installed, the terminal will return the current version.<\/p>\n\n\n\n<p>If any command is unavailable, the terminal will normally indicate that the program cannot be found.<\/p>\n\n\n\n<p>Therefore, these quick checks can prevent you from planning a workflow around a tool that is not present in the current environment.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Run Python with an Ubuntu online compiler environment<\/h2>\n\n\n\n<p>Python is one of the simplest languages to test from a Linux terminal because it normally does not require a separate compilation step.<\/p>\n\n\n\n<p>First, check whether Python is available:<\/p>\n\n\n\n<p><code>python3 --version<\/code><\/p>\n\n\n\n<p>Next, create a simple file named:<\/p>\n\n\n\n<p><code>hello.py<\/code><\/p>\n\n\n\n<p>Add:<\/p>\n\n\n\n<pre class=\"wp-block-code\"><code>print(\"Hello from Ubuntu\")<\/code><\/pre>\n\n\n\n<p>After saving the file, run:<\/p>\n\n\n\n<p><code>python3 hello.py<\/code><\/p>\n\n\n\n<p>The terminal should display:<\/p>\n\n\n\n<p><code>Hello from Ubuntu<\/code><\/p>\n\n\n\n<p>This basic workflow is useful for learning how files and commands work together inside Linux.<\/p>\n\n\n\n<p>Moreover, it gives beginners experience with running Python outside a graphical IDE.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Compile C code in Ubuntu online<\/h2>\n\n\n\n<p>If GCC is available, you can also compile a simple C program.<\/p>\n\n\n\n<p>First, create a file called:<\/p>\n\n\n\n<p><code>hello.c<\/code><\/p>\n\n\n\n<p>Add:<\/p>\n\n\n\n<pre class=\"wp-block-code\"><code>#include &lt;stdio.h&gt;\n\nint main() {\n    printf(\"Hello from Ubuntu\\n\");\n    return 0;\n}<\/code><\/pre>\n\n\n\n<p>Next, compile it with:<\/p>\n\n\n\n<p><code>gcc hello.c -o hello<\/code><\/p>\n\n\n\n<p>If the compilation finishes without errors, run the program:<\/p>\n\n\n\n<p><code>.\/hello<\/code><\/p>\n\n\n\n<p>The terminal should return:<\/p>\n\n\n\n<p><code>Hello from Ubuntu<\/code><\/p>\n\n\n\n<p>In other words, you have followed the basic Linux C workflow:<\/p>\n\n\n\n<p><strong>source code \u2192 compiler \u2192 executable \u2192 run<\/strong><\/p>\n\n\n\n<p>This workflow differs from using a simple web compiler because you can see how the executable is created inside the Linux environment.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Compile C++ in an Ubuntu online environment<\/h2>\n\n\n\n<p>C++ follows a similar process when <code>g++<\/code> is available.<\/p>\n\n\n\n<p>Start by creating:<\/p>\n\n\n\n<p><code>hello.cpp<\/code><\/p>\n\n\n\n<p>Then add:<\/p>\n\n\n\n<pre class=\"wp-block-code\"><code>#include &lt;iostream&gt;\n\nint main() {\n    std::cout &lt;&lt; \"Hello from Ubuntu\" &lt;&lt; std::endl;\n    return 0;\n}<\/code><\/pre>\n\n\n\n<p>Next, compile it:<\/p>\n\n\n\n<p><code>g++ hello.cpp -o hello<\/code><\/p>\n\n\n\n<p>Finally, run:<\/p>\n\n\n\n<p><code>.\/hello<\/code><\/p>\n\n\n\n<p>As a result, an <strong>Ubuntu online compiler<\/strong> can be particularly useful for students learning not only C++ syntax but also how compilation works inside Linux.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Use Bash and Linux commands online<\/h2>\n\n\n\n<p>Coding inside Ubuntu is not limited to traditional programming languages.<\/p>\n\n\n\n<p>You can also practice Bash and standard Linux commands.<\/p>\n\n\n\n<p>For example:<\/p>\n\n\n\n<p><code>pwd<\/code><\/p>\n\n\n\n<p>shows your current directory.<\/p>\n\n\n\n<p>Meanwhile:<\/p>\n\n\n\n<p><code>ls<\/code><\/p>\n\n\n\n<p>lists files and directories.<\/p>\n\n\n\n<p>To create a directory called <code>project<\/code>, use:<\/p>\n\n\n\n<p><code>mkdir project<\/code><\/p>\n\n\n\n<p>Then move into that directory with:<\/p>\n\n\n\n<p><code>cd project<\/code><\/p>\n\n\n\n<p>You can also create a simple Bash script.<\/p>\n\n\n\n<p>Create a file called:<\/p>\n\n\n\n<p><code>hello.sh<\/code><\/p>\n\n\n\n<p>Then add:<\/p>\n\n\n\n<pre class=\"wp-block-code\"><code>#!\/bin\/bash\necho \"Hello from Bash\"<\/code><\/pre>\n\n\n\n<p>Finally, run it with:<\/p>\n\n\n\n<p><code>bash hello.sh<\/code><\/p>\n\n\n\n<p>For beginners, this is useful because it connects programming concepts with the Linux command-line environment.<\/p>\n\n\n\n<p>If your main goal is learning Linux commands rather than compiling programs,
